Understanding the Dynamics of the Crash Game
The fundamental principle of a crash game revolves around a rising multiplier curve. Each round begins with a multiplier of 1x, and this value steadily ascends over time. Players place their initial bet before the start of each round, and their potential payout increases proportionally to the multiplier at the moment they choose to “cash out.” This simple mechanic creates a compelling loop: the longer you wait, the higher the potential reward, but also the greater the risk of losing your entire wager. The game uses a provably fair system, often relying on cryptographic algorithms to ensure randomness and transparency, building trust with players who want to verify the integrity of each round. A key aspect is recognizing that the “crash” point is determined randomly and independently for each round; past results have no bearing on future outcomes. Therefore, relying on patterns or predictions based on previous crashes is generally not a viable strategy.

Strategies for Playing Crash Games
While there's no foolproof strategy to guarantee wins in a crash game, several approaches can improve your chances and manage your risk. One popular tactic is the "auto-cashout" feature, available on most platforms. This allows players to set a target multiplier, and the game will automatically cash out when that multiplier is reached. This is particularly useful for mitigating the emotional pressure of manually timing cashouts. Another strategy involves employing a "martingale" system, where players double their bet after each loss, aiming to recoup their losses with a single win; however, this strategy requires a substantial bankroll and carries significant risk, as losing streaks can quickly deplete funds. Successful players also often diversify their bets, placing smaller wagers on multiple rounds rather than a single large bet, spreading the risk across a wider range of outcomes.
The Importance of Bankroll Management
Perhaps the most crucial aspect of playing crash games is responsible bankroll management. Establish a predetermined budget for your gaming sessions and strictly adhere to it. Never chase losses by increasing your bets beyond your comfort level. A common rule of thumb is to only bet a small percentage of your total bankroll on each round – typically between 1% and 5%. This minimizes the impact of losing streaks and allows you to withstand periods of unfavorable outcomes. Remember that crash games are designed to be entertaining, and treating them as a source of income can lead to financial difficulties. Prioritize responsible gaming practices and only wager what you can afford to lose.
- Set a loss limit: Decide how much you are willing to lose before you start playing, and stop when you reach that limit.
- Set a win target: Similarly, establish a target profit. Once you reach it, cash out and enjoy your winnings.
- Use the auto-cashout feature: This removes the emotion from the equation and ensures you secure a profit at your chosen multiplier.
- Start with small bets: Get a feel for the game and the platform before wagering larger amounts.
- Understand the risk: Always remember that crash games are inherently risky, and there's no guarantee of winning.
These simple guidelines can significantly improve your long-term results and protect your bankroll.
Psychological Factors in Crash Game Play
The emotional roller coaster inherent in crash games often leads to irrational decision-making. The increasing multiplier can trigger a sense of greed, tempting players to hold on for a bigger payout, even when the risk is substantial. Fear of missing out (FOMO) can also play a role, as players observe others cashing out at high multipliers. Conversely, experiencing consecutive losses can lead to frustration and impulsive betting, often resulting in further losses. Successful players are able to detach themselves emotionally from the game and make rational decisions based on probability and risk assessment. Being aware of these psychological biases is the first step towards mitigating their impact.
